Norwegian startup Blastr plans €4B green steel plant in Finland

Green Car Congress

Norwegian startup Blastr Green Steel is planning to establish a green steel plant with an integrated hydrogen production facility in Inkoo, Finland. The area has excellent conditions for industrial activities: a deep-water harbor and an excellent electricity transmission network. Finland is an ideal location for our project.

Stellantis and Terrafame agree on low-carbon nickel sulfate supply for EV batteries

Green Car Congress

signed a supply agreement for nickel sulfate to be used in electric vehicle (EV) batteries. Beginning in 2025, Finland-based Terrafame will supply Stellantis with nickel sulfate over the five-year term of the agreement. Stellantis N.V. and Terrafame Ltd.

Stora Enso’s pilot plant for producing lignin-based carbon materials for batteries now operational

Green Car Congress

Stora Enso’s pilot facility for producing bio-based carbon materials from lignin has started operations. Pilot production of Lignode by Stora Enso, wood-based carbon for batteries, is currently being ramped up. Stora Enso Lignode carbon powder. Today, fossil-based carbon is used in the anodes of rechargeable batteries.

Stora Enso building €10M pilot plant to produce hard carbon from lignin; electrode materials

Green Car Congress

Stora Enso is investing €10 million to build a pilot facility for producing bio-based carbon materials based on lignin. Wood-based carbon can be utilized as a crucial component in batteries typically used in consumer electronics, the automotive industry and large-scale energy storage systems.

Finnish Minerals Group & FREYR Battery collaborate to develop LFP cathode materials plant in Finland

Green Car Congress

Finnish Minerals Group, a mining and battery industry development and investment company, and FREYR Battery will cooperate to assess the feasibility of establishing an LFP cathode material plant in the city of Vaasa. Betolar and JA-KO Betoni to use Keliber’s lithium mine side streams for lower-carbon concrete

Green Car Congress

Betolar, a Finnish material technology company that offers sustainable and low-carbon concrete production, and concrete company JA-KO Betoni, are assisting Keliber ( earlier post ), which is preparing a lithium mine in Kaustinen, Finland, in utilizing the massive side streams typically produced in the mining industry.
